The easiest way to tell if a 1973 quarter is large or small bust is to compare it to a 1972 quarter. Look at the hair, the small bust variety has a lot more detail than a large bust.

Seems to me that the bottom left one might be large bust because the A in regina is pointing at the rim bead...That how you know if you have a large bust 1973.
